TIP! You should examine the surrounding neighborhood of any commercial real estate you may be interested in. A business located in a well-to-do neighborhood might be more successful, since the potential customers will be able to spend more.

Always check the credentials of the inspectors you hire. There are many non-accredited people who work in such fields as insect removal. This can keep you from having bigger headaches after the sale.

TIP! Try to carefully limit the situations that are specified as event of default criteria prior to executing a lease for commercial property. That will cut down on the likelihood that the tenant defaults on a lease.

Be careful to choose commercial properties that are solidly and simply constructed if you plan to use them as rental properties. Tenants will be more likely to rent space in this type of building, as it looks taken care of. These properties are also more cost effective for you and your tenants due to the fact that they only require minimal upkeep and repairs.
